My Project
My students are full of curiosity and excitement for learning! Every day, they enter our classroom eager to explore new ideas, build foundational skills, and engage with one another in meaningful ways. Many of my students are learning in a school where resources are limited, yet their enthusiasm for discovery knows no bounds. To support their growth, I strive to create an engaging, hands-on learning environment where they can thrive.
The Mobile Teaching Easel from Lakeshore Learning would be a game-changer for our classroom!
This versatile easel will allow me to conduct interactive lessons, display anchor charts, and engage students in shared writing and reading activities. The dry-erase surface will be perfect for whole-group instruction, while the storage bins will keep materials organized and easily accessible. With a magnetic surface, I can use visual aids to support different learning styles, making lessons more engaging and effective.
Having this easel will encourage collaboration as students can actively participate in lessons, manipulate magnetic letters, and share their thinking in a visible way. It will also provide a central learning hub, making transitions between activities smoother and maximizing instructional time.
